I sit here this morning reading the comments from my post, and feel rather guilty of putting a negative vibe out regarding My Plus 6. Every car I suppose has the good, bad and ugly attributes. And I reckon if it is going to be your third car, 3 to 4 k a year for pure fun days out and a trip to France, it will obviously do the job. And to reiterate, I was hard on my car over 3 years. And it was the salt in the roads which wrecked the window surrounding and the the fuel filler, and rusted the fittings which held all the plastic inners on, hence falling onto the tyres🤷‍♂️. The water ingress was the worst . Again because I often left it out in winter. Even with factory hard top. Water rolled down and found its way under the mats, which of course don’t come out the car unless you take seat out!

You can’t really compare my RS product I now have on my drive against a Morgan. It’s a totally different animal. Refinement, water tight, solid. What I will point out is that my 3 year old used RS was 52k. 2 years warranty, cheaper to insure and tax. It will still lose money, but not £42k over 3 years like my Plus 6 did.

As some of you know I live near the factory, Plus six now out of production, Plus 4 next ?

Please all enjoy your cars, I’ll probably be jealous when I see you out in them. Enjoy .

I don't think you were unfairly critical, it 's now part and parcel of the new CX Morgan ownership reality.

I think the Midsummer limited edition in collaboration with outside designers may be the way forward for Morgan. Developing exclusive cars for markets such as the Middle East where the likes of hoods and other everyday considerations just don't matter, as much as the pursuit of exclusivity, is more key to the ownership buying criteria. Why deal with mere mortals if you can gain access to the really wealthy.

Indeed. If MMC can get their products into Veblen Goods territory they can relax a bit. But I think they might need to get their production quality absolutely nailed to do so. No more radiator debacles.

That's the thing about flogging stuff to die-hard enthusiasts, we've always been prepared to forgive. The ultra-wealthy are a good deal less patient.
